Beautiful weather is expected for a huge weekend ahead in historic Uptown Westerville, with the Fourth Friday street festival set for 6-9 p.m. Sept. 26, and the final Westerville Saturday Farmers Market of the year set for 9 a.m. to noon Sept. 27.

MSN Weather forecasts Friday evening will be partly cloudy and 73 degrees at 6 p.m., dropping to 64 degrees at 9 p.m.

Saturday morning may be even nicer, still partly cloudy, but starting at 60 degrees at 9 a.m. and rising to 74 at noon.

Presented by Mount Carmel St. Ann’s Hospital, Fourth Fridays are staged by Uptown Westerville Inc. Highlights Sept. 26 will include:

Concert

The Fabulous Johnson Brothers will perform from 6:30-8:30 p.m. in front of Hanby Elementary School, 56 S. State St., for the last Newman Roofing Summer Concert Series concert of 2025.

Arts Alley

Arts Alley presented by the Arts Council of Westerville will set up in the parking lot of Fattey Beer/Fox in the Snow at 79 S. State St. Find artists exhibiting their works, demonstrations by featured artists, including Megan Brown from Daylight Collective Artists, the Kids Art Tent, live music and more at Arts Alley Sept. 26.

Science Street

The Ohio State University Society of Women Engineers will set up along the east side of State Street, between Dairy Queen, 84 S. State, and the Westerville Public Library, 126 S. State. One hand-on activity organized by OSUSWE members will include the creation of paper lanterns (see photo in slideshow below).

Joining OSUSWE on “Science Street” this Fourth Friday will be the mobile “Curbside COSI Connects” science exhibit with hands-on demonstrations.

Science Street for 2025 is sponsored by The Westerville Fund.

Westerville Symphony

Westerville Symphony members will set up and perform near the northwest corner of West Main and State streets.

Fourth Friday on the Lawn

The Westerville Jazz Orchestra will perform from 6-8 p.m. on the front lawn of the Westerville Public Library, 126 S. State St. Singer Dawn Eller will be featured.

Bike parking behind Los Altos

Ride your bikes to Fourth Friday and safely lock up at the Fourth Friday Bike Parking hosted by Keller Williams Greater Columbus – The Romanelli Group and the Westerville Bike Shop, from 6-9 p.m. The bike parking location for 2025 is at 23 E. College Ave., behind Los Altos.

Also at Fourth Friday Sept. 26, catch:

  • Demonstrations and info from Paddle Taps along East College Avenue. The indoor pickleball venue is located on Lakeview Plaza in Worthington.
  • DJ Matt Ryan will spin up his monthly teen dance party in Uptown’s Rotary Park, at the southeast corner of Home and State streets, near the Columbus Running Company, 50 N. State St.

And the 2025 season for the Westerville Saturday Farmers Market turns to its final stanza this weekend. The final Market of the year will take place from 9 a.m. to noon Sept. 27, on the campus of COhatch Westerville and the North High Brewing Taproom, 240 S. State St.

Held for several years in the parking lots behind Westerville City Hall, 21 S. State St., the Market was displaced by the City Hall expansion project for this year.

COhatch and North High managers graciously stepped up to offer their lovely 2.3-acre grounds to Uptown Westerville Inc. as a Market venue for 2025, and residents and vendors have loved the new setup.

Don’t miss your last chance to shop the market at this location. Park across the street at Cornerstone Community Church, 233 S. State St. Additional parking is available a short walk up the Westerville Bike Trail from the Market at the City of Westerville building, 64 E. Walnut St., and the adjacent lots of the Westerville Public Library.
